Microsoft Intune in the Azure portal Preview

Microsoft Intune is moving to the Azure portal and the public preview has started.  The initial release includes the following capabilities:

  • Deploy and manage apps from a store to iOS, Android, and Windows devices
  • Deploy and manage line of business (LOB) apps to iOS, Android, and Windows devices
  • Deploy and manage volume-purchased apps to iOS, and Windows devices
  • Deploy and manage web apps for Android, iOS, and Windows devices
  • Volume-purchased apps for iOS (business and education)
  • iOS managed app configuration profiles
  • Configure app protection policies, and deploy LOB apps to devices that are not enrolled with Intune
  • VPN profiles, per-app VPN, Wi-Fi, email, and certificate profiles
  • Compliance policies
  • Conditional access for Azure AD
  • Conditional access for On-Premises Exchange
  • Device enrollment
  • Role-based access control
